  6. an unknown element x has three naturally occurring isotopes:

x - 35: mass = 34.96885 amu, % abundance = 75.76%
x - 37: mass = 36.96590 amu, % abundance = 24.24%
x - 39: mass = 38.96371 amu, % abundance = 0.20%
a. calculate the average atomic mass of x. show all work for full credit.

b. identify the unknown element with name and atomic number:

Explanation:

Step1: Calculate the contribution of each isotope

For \(X - 35\):

$$34.96885\times0.7576 = 26.516$$

For \(X - 37\):

$$36.96590\times0.2424 = 8.9688$$

For \(X - 38\):

$$38.96371\times0.0020 = 0.0779$$

Step2: Sum up the contributions

$$26.516+8.9688 + 0.0779=35.5627\approx35.56$$

Chlorine (\(Cl\)) has an average atomic mass of approximately \(35.45\) amu (close to our calculated value of \(35.56\) amu considering rounding differences in the problem - given data). The atomic number of chlorine is \(17\).

Answer:

The average atomic mass of \(X\) is \(35.56\) amu.
